The dimensions of a box are x, 2x, and 3x. Each dimension is increased by 2. Calculate the volume of the box.

Answer:

  6x^3 +22x^2 +24x +8

Step-by-step explanation:

The dimensions of the larger box are ...

  (x+2), (2x+2), and (3x+2)

The volume is the product of these dimensions.

  V = LWH

  V = (x+2)(2x+2)(3x+2) = (x +2)(6x^2 +10x +4)

  V = 6x^3 +22x^2 +24x +8

The volume of the box is 6x^3 +22x^2 +24x +8.
